How Espresso’s HotShot Consensus Addresses the Rollup Centralization and Fragmentation Crisis
Analysisblockchain infrastructurecross-chain composabilitydecentralized sequencerEspresso SystemsHotShot consensusLayer 2 RollupsRollup fragmentationshared sequencing
TLDR: Espresso’s decentralized shared sequencer eliminates single points of failure in Rollup transaction ordering. HotShot consensus achieves two-second finality on devnet with plans for sub-second confirmation by 2026. Presto enables one-click cross-chain transactions without traditional bridging or additional gas fees. The network integrates with over 20 chains while preserving Rollup sovereignty through flexible participation. [...]
